Transaction 29af346cc5de198de149b85ec27f134e6a02a00c0a462dc03f407216e84d7313

8 Input
2 Outputs
  • 29af346cc5de198de149b85ec27f134e6a02a00c0a462dc03f407216e84d7313:0
  • value  759547
    address  1ESeRHx43gwEUBdnFSQSaqPaf5NTePZ4ss
  • 29af346cc5de198de149b85ec27f134e6a02a00c0a462dc03f407216e84d7313:1
  • value  18088874
    address  3DHfcdLNUwVuqXLoBm8e8ynLrWT1eeC7d6